Post-marketing surveillance is a critical component of pharmaceutical regulation, often uncovering unanticipated adverse drug reactions (ADRs) once a drug is widely used over an extended period.
This process, termed pharmacovigilance, aims to detect, evaluate, and minimize harmful effects related to medication use. The data collection for pharmacovigilance depends on spontaneous reporting systems, where healthcare professionals or patients voluntarily report suspected ADRs.

Solid dosage forms such as tablets and capsules undergo rigorous manufacturing processes to ensure stability and effectiveness. Their dissolution and absorption properties are influenced significantly by the choice of excipients (inactive ingredients that serve various roles in the formulation), and the methodology applied during production. While local anesthetics are generally safe and well-tolerated, they can occasionally cause adverse effects that vary in severity. Local anesthetics can induce toxicity at two distinct levels. They can either produce local effects through direct contact with the neural elements or be absorbed into the bloodstream from the injection site, leading to systemic effects.

Drugs, encompassing various chemical compounds from natural sources, lab synthesis, or genetic engineering, elicit different biological responses in living organisms. Some of these responses are desirable or therapeutic, while others are undesirable. The primary goal of administering a drug is to achieve a therapeutic effect, that is, to address a specific disease or health condition. In cases of acute poisoning, the primary objective is to prevent further absorption of the toxic substance into the body. Immediate interventions using various decontamination techniques targeting the gastrointestinal (GI) tract can achieve this. Decontamination is crucial to prevent poison from entering the systemic circulation, which involves washing affected areas with water and mild soap and removing contaminated clothing. Excipients and Adverse Events.

Loyd V Allen1

  • 1International Journal of Pharmaceutical Compounding. lallen@ijpc.com.

International Journal of Pharmaceutical Compounding
|October 10, 2023
PubMed
Summary
This summary is machine-generated.

Pharmaceutical excipients are crucial inactive ingredients in medications. This article discusses their purpose, selection, formulation, examples, incompatibilities, and adverse effects for pharmacists and manufacturers.

Background:

  • Pharmaceutical excipients are integral components of drug formulations, serving critical roles beyond the active pharmaceutical ingredient.
  • Understanding excipient functionality is essential for successful drug product development and manufacturing.

Purpose of the Study:

  • To provide a comprehensive overview of pharmaceutical excipients.
  • To detail the purpose, selection criteria, and application of excipients in formulation development.
  • To highlight potential excipient incompatibilities and adverse effects.

Main Methods:

  • Literature review and synthesis of existing knowledge on pharmaceutical excipients.
  • Discussion of key considerations in excipient selection and usage.
  • Compilation of common excipient examples, incompatibilities, and adverse effects.

Main Results:

  • Excipients serve diverse functions including aiding manufacturing, enhancing stability, and controlling drug release.
  • Appropriate excipient selection requires consideration of drug properties, desired dosage form, and potential interactions.
  • Numerous incompatibilities and potential adverse effects necessitate careful evaluation during formulation.

Conclusions:

  • Pharmaceutical excipients are vital for effective drug formulation and delivery.
  • Thorough understanding and careful selection of excipients are critical to ensure drug safety, efficacy, and stability.
  • This review serves as a guide for pharmacists and manufacturers in optimizing drug formulations.
